So much confusion here.

PPO works for all years with no minimum load required if the truck is turned on.

Starting with 2024, there is a Sync option to use PPO with the truck off. In this mode, there is a minimum load required.

Just push the unlock button on your remote, (and within 1 min.) reach into The bed, and push the pro power button. All outlets are ready to go.
No need to start the truck. That’s how it works in my ‘24.
And it activates the interior outlets too.
